Transaction 65d2d793384fb105c77088214e2523d7eda96f64f008377af793c57e70957cc9

1 Input
2 Outputs
  • 65d2d793384fb105c77088214e2523d7eda96f64f008377af793c57e70957cc9:0
  • value  27112952
    address  33Bw1ft9ekVwVy2gXWWsvrL6L1G3oCgqwW
  • 65d2d793384fb105c77088214e2523d7eda96f64f008377af793c57e70957cc9:1
  • value  2000000
    address  12unK2ffQ62vi1RWDsMW4FtFDBC6y4qNux